Summary

After being scattered across the globe, our heroes seek to reunite with each other. But the consequences of recent events continue to plague them.

Cooper enters the Fertile Desert, in search of Nabi. Katherine seeks to escape the drow island, and take back her ship. Julian tries to placate Akane, while keeping Chaz out of trouble. Stacy, having deemed Dave a lost cause, vows revenge on the ettins, who continue their destructive rampage in the Cedar Wilds. Dave, finally free of Stacy's yoke, sets his sights on power and wealth. And Tim....What the hell is Tim up to?

Meanwhile, Mordred's army of brainwashed Knights spread ever farther, in their search for his dice.
